The US base salary range for this full-time position is $110,000-$162,000 + bonus + equity + benefits. Our salary ranges are determined by role, level, and location. The range displayed on each job posting reflects the minimum and maximum target salaries for the position across all US locations. Within the range, individual pay is determined by work location and additional factors, including job-related skills, experience, and relevant education or training. Your recruiter can share more about the specific salary range for your preferred location during the hiring process.

Please note that the compensation details listed in US role postings reflect the base salary only, and do not include bonus, equity, or benefits. Learn more about benefits at Google .

Responsibilities

  • Manage the CEO's calendar, schedule meetings, and arrange travel.
  • Prepare and distribute meeting agendas, minutes, and presentations.
  • Complete expense reports and handle travel budget.
  • Arrange complex and detailed travel plans, itineraries, and agendas, including compiling documents for travel-related meetings.
  • Work closely and effectively with the CEO to keep them well informed of upcoming commitments and responsibilities, following up appropriately.
